Extra-big smile today on our anniversary! Exactly one year ago today, August 19, 2019, I dropped off our well-loved but well-used 2014 Explorer at my local Ford dealer and picked up our new Ranger Lariat FX4 with the Black Appearance Package! Since the wife and I have been working from home since spring, we have only put c. 9,000 miles on it overall, about half of what we were doing per year pre-Covid-19 on the Explorer. Major mods include the Ford Performance Two-Inch Leveling Kit, the Ford Performance Power Pack Tune, Falcon Wildpeaks, and, hell yeah, a Dee Zee Tailgate assist! I am so jealous! My son bought me a ‘20 Ranger XL. Absolutely blew me away! Was driving it everywhere and running every errand. Then the dreaded ‘orange engine light’ started glowing. Neither Ford nor the dealership had an idea of what was wrong. Now they have had the truck more than I have. Replaced the ‘turbo’ fuel pump twice and still no answer. Anyone else had issues with fuel pumps on ‘20 Rangers? I want my truck back or one that actually works.
Any help is much appreciated- Ford dealership has not been communicative or helpful.
